Extension of Payment Deadline for 10% Subscription Call

Ong Vice President, Listings & Disclosure Group SUBJECT : Extension of Payment Deadline for 10% Subscription Call Gentlemen : This is to confirm our earlier telephone advise that at the Regular Meeting of the Board of Directors of THE PHILODRILL CORPORATION (the "Company") held today, 26 August 1998, starting from 1:30 p.m., the Board passed and approved the following resolutions extending the deadline for payment of the Ten Percent (10%) subscription call from 31 August 1998 to 30 October 1998, as follows: "WHEREAS, pursuant to a Board Resolution dated 29 July 1998, the Company issued a call for payment of all unpaid and outstanding 1994 subscriptions to the extent of TEN PERCENT (10%) of the subscription amount, payable on or before 31 August 1998; "Whereas, citing the prevailing economic conditions and the current state of the local stock market, shareholders of the Company have requested for an extension of the payment deadline set for the said 10% subscription call; "NOW, THEREFORE, in view of the foregoing premises, the Board of Directors, after due deliberation and upon motion duly made and seconded, passed and approved the following resolutions: "RESOLVED, as it is hereby resolved, to authorize the acceptance of payments made by shareholders pursuant to the Company's call for payment of all outstanding and unpaid 1994 subscriptions, to the extent of Ten Percent (10%) of the subscription amount, up to and until 30 October 1998 without imposition of penalty and/or interest charges thereon." This formal written advise on the foregoing matter is submitted in compliance with the rules and regulations of the Philippine Stock Exchange. Very truly yours, (SGD.) ADRIAN S.
